If you receive a considerable number of emails daily, having the Unread Mail folder visible is very useful for scanning and reading all new unread emails in a single folder view. If you have multiple rules in Outlook for incoming emails, you will find new emails in every folder of your Outlook. ![]() If you encounter a similar scenario, here is how to add the Unread folder in Outlook 365 and other Office versions under Favourites. ![]() Recently, one of the users complained that he couldn’t find it under ‘Favourites’ where it used to appear. The ‘Unread Mail’ is one of the useful folders in Microsoft Outlook to view unread emails in one place from other mail folders in a particular Outlook account. ![]()
